Andean Precious Metals Revenue
Andean Precious Metals had revenue of $61.98M USD in the quarter ending March 31, 2025, with 43.90% growth. This brings the company's revenue in the last twelve months to $272.91M, up 87.76% year-over-year. In the year 2024, Andean Precious Metals had annual revenue of $254.00M with 102.67% growth.

Revenue Definition
Revenue, also called sales, is the amount of money a company receives from its business activities, such as sales of products or services. Revenue does not take any expenses into account and is therefore different from profits.
